Upcoming Route AF Bridge Replacement Project in Wright County…

Notice of Opportunity for Public Meeting

SIKESTON-The Missouri Department of Transportation plans to replace the Route AF bridge over Beaver Creek in Wright County. This structure is located between Crisptown Road and County Road 394 near Moore Hollow.

Work to improve the bridge could begin as early as summer 2025. As construction is underway, the roadway will be closed in the vicinity of the bridge for approximately three months. A signed detour will be in place.

Maps, plans, and other information prepared by MoDOT will be available for public inspection and copying at MoDOT's Willow Springs regional office, 3956 E. Main St., Willow Springs, Missouri. Any person affected by this project may request that a public meeting be held in regard to the proposed improvements.

For more information, please contact MoDOT Project Manager Pete Berry at (417) 469-6242 or MoDOT Area Engineer Elquin Auala at (417) 469-6286. Comments and questions may also be submitted online at www.modot.org/form/AFbeaverwright. Please submit comments by July 12, 2024.
